Raw Material Preparation
- Silica sand (70-74% of batch)
- Soda ash (12-16%)
- Limestone (10-12%)
- Recycled glass cullet (20-40%)

Melting & Forming Techniques
Method | Temperature Range | Common Applications |
---|---|---|
Float Glass | 1,500-1,600°C | Architectural windows |
Blow & Blow | 1,100-1,300°C | Bottle manufacturing |
Fiber Drawing | 1,200-1,400°C | Optical cables |

Sustainability Challenges
While glass is infinitely recyclable, the industry faces:
- Energy consumption: 4-6 MJ per kg produced
- CO₂ emissions: 0.7-1.0 tons per ton of glass
